Master Rapid Decision-Making Frameworks

Decisiveness often defines leadership effectiveness, but it must be balanced with thoughtful analysis. Leadership schools introduce frameworks such as OODA Loop (Observe, Orient, Decide, Act) and DECIDE models that empower leaders to make informed decisions swiftly.

These tools distill complex problems into manageable steps, removing hesitation and enhancing confidence. By internalizing such frameworks, leaders can shift from paralysis by analysis to prompt, impactful action—hallmarks of leadership strategies fast that yield results in real time.

Implement Agile Leadership Techniques

Agility, borrowed from the world of software development, has become an essential principle in modern leadership. Agile leadership involves iterative planning, adaptability, and continuous feedback loops. Leadership schools incorporate agile methodologies as part of their leadership strategies fast arsenal.

Leaders trained in agile techniques can pivot quickly when circumstances shift, recalibrate goals with their teams, and maintain momentum in the face of uncertainty. This nimbleness is particularly vital in environments marked by rapid technological advances and shifting market demands.
